Irene’s Fruit Mince Tart

Found a bottle of fruit mince at the back of my grocery cupboard….just loved how the festive aroma filled the house on this cold day.

Crust
500ml plain flour
80ml sugar
160g cold butter, grated
1 egg yolk
2 tablespoons iced water

To make the crust, mix / rub / process in food processor the flour, sugar and butter until it resembles fine breadcrumbs.
Add the egg yolk and water, and mix until the mixture just starts to come together.
Form into a disc, cover in cling wrap and refrigerate for a minimum of 15 mins.
Roll out the dough to fit your pie dish.
Keep a quarter of the dough to grate over the top of the filling.
Fill the pie crust generously with fruit mince.
Grate the dough that you kept aside over the fruit mince.
Sprinkle the top with flaked coconut and almonds.
Bake for +-25 minutes or until the crust is light golden.

PS… You could make two tarts with this amount of dough but I love a thick crust so made one. You could also make small tarts in a muffin pan if you prefer.
